Checking for coolant leaks
1. Check the coolant level.
2. Remove the radiator cap.
3. Using a special adapter, connect the cooling system leak tester to the radiator filler neck.

Caution: Creating pressure in the cooling system above 123 kPa may cause damage to cooling system components and coolant leaks.
4. Create pressure in the radiator.
Pressure - 93 - 123 kPa
5. Make sure that the pressure does not drop for some time. If the pressure drops, check the system for leaks.
